WebDec 8, 2024 · 1. Resign in Writing Under an Australian Power of Attorney. In every case, regardless of the type of Australian power of attorney and whether or not the principal has capacity, an attorney should always resign by signed notice in writing to the principal. WebA power of attorney in South Australia is a legally binding document which gives someone the power to act as your agent and make decisions on your behalf. In SA, the document is referred to as a ‘Deed’, the person making the power of attorney is known as the ‘donor’ and the attorney is referred to as the ‘donee.’.

WebMar 20, 2024 · The benefit of an EPA is that, unlike an ordinary power of attorney, it will continue to operate even if the person who made the document (the donor) loses full legal capacity. When a person makes an Enduring Power of Attorney, they can choose for their attorney’s authority to start immediately or only if they lose capacity. WebMar 12, 2024 · A Power of Attorney is a formal document which gives another person (your agent) the authority or the right to make and carry out decisions for you. The power can be specific to a certain task or broad to cover many financial and legal duties. The power can be given to start immediately, or upon mental incapacity.
